Advantages 5 AXIS CNC for Boat Molds

One-setup full machiningNo repeated disassembly & repositioning; eliminates alignment errors between segmented mold sections, critical for smooth continuous hull curves.
Greatly reduce manual fairing workTilt cutter to machine surface at normal angle, ultra-smooth finish; manual sanding labor cut by ~70% vs hand-sculpted or 3-axis segmented molds.
Handle undercuts & deep cavities easily3-axis machines cannot reach inward curved hull contours; 5-axis swinging spindle clears all complex negative shapes directly.
Higher production efficiencyMold cycle shortened from weeks to days; overall machining speed up 40%+ vs traditional equipment.
Stable precision on oversized workpiecesAnti-thermal expansion structure maintains tight tolerance over 10+ meter long hulls, consistent hydrodynamic hull lines for better boat performance.
Lower long-term labor costLess skilled mold sculptors needed; digital CAD/CAM files replicate identical hull plugs for mass production.

How 5-Axis CNC Router Quality Impacts Its Price (Boat Manufacturing Models)
This is the most critical part for boat curved surfaces and undercuts.
Low quality: Pseudo 5-axis / non-RTCP headSimple single-axis tilt structure, no real-time tool center point control. Cannot machine deep hull undercuts smoothly, heavy vibration when cutting large foam blanks.Cost impact: Cuts machine price by 35%–50%. Only fit tiny simple boat prototypes.
Mid quality: Domestic A/C swing head, ±90° tilt, basic RTCPStable for small-to-medium speedboat plugs, light foam cutting, limited continuous 5-axis linkage.Cost impact: Standard baseline price for Chinese marine routers.
High quality: Imported full swing head (Hiteco / Demas), ±120° tilt, heavy-duty bearingZero backlash, long service life for daily heavy cutting of epoxy board and FRP. Perfect for full yacht hulls with complex concave lines.Cost impact: Adds $9,000–$25,000 to total machine cost.

Boat molds require extra-large tables (3m–20m long), so frame thickness determines stability.
Low quality: Thin welded steel, weak gantry, no stress reliefEasy deformation after 1–2 years of heavy cutting; hull molds end up with uneven curved surfaces, poor hydrodynamic precision.Cost impact: Reduces price by 20%–30%. Thin steel saves raw material and processing labor.
Mid quality: Medium-thick steel, basic stress relief annealingStable for small boat mass production, slight deformation risk on machines over 8m long. Standard mid-tier model cost.
High quality: Thick heavy steel, full annealing, reinforced crossbeams, anti-vibration designNo deformation over 10+ years, consistent ±0.02mm precision on 15m superyacht plugs.Cost impact: Raw steel and heat treatment raise price by $12,000–$40,000 for oversized marine gantries.

Marine routers cut soft foam and hard epoxy/carbon fiber, so spindle durability matters greatly.
Low quality: Low-power domestic air-cooled spindle (6–9kW)Fast wear, loud vibration, cannot cut dense epoxy tooling board. Only for lightweight foam roughing.Cost impact: Saves $4,000–$10,000 vs imported heavy spindles.
Mid quality: Domestic water-cooled spindle (9–18kW)Balanced for small yacht workshops, stable daily foam processing.
High quality: Imported Italian Hiteco / HSD water-cooled spindle (18–33kW)Low runout error, continuous 24-hour cutting, suitable for hard composite mold materials.Cost impact: Upgrades add $7,000–$22,000.

Controls decide surface smoothness of hull curves and five-axis linkage stability.
Low quality: Entry-level RichAuto simple controllerLimited five-axis functions, rough curved surface finish, frequent toolpath lag on large boat models.Cost impact: Lowest control cost, reduce machine price by $6,000–$18,000.
Mid quality: Syntec industrial CNC, complete RTCP functionIndustry standard for Chinese marine CNC routers, stable for most boat manufacturers.
High quality: OSAI / Siemens 840D / Heidenhain closed-loop control with linear scalesUltra-smooth five-axis movement, zero positioning drift, top precision for luxury yacht molds.Cost impact: Premium control upgrades add $20,000–$85,000.
Low quality: Ordinary square rails, plastic gear racks, open-loop stepper motorsBig backlash, rough cutting texture, poor repeat accuracy on repeated hull mold copies. Low manufacturing cost.
Mid quality: Domestic heavy-duty linear rails, helical rack, servo motors semi-closed loopStandard configuration for mid-size boat factories.
High quality: Imported HIWIN/THK heavy load rails, hardened helical rack, full closed-loop servo + linear grating scalesMinimal backlash, consistent precision after thousands of hours cutting.Cost impact: High-end transmission system increases price by $5,000–$15,000.
